diff options
Diffstat (limited to 'src/com/android/launcher3/SearchDropTargetBar.java')
-rw-r--r-- | src/com/android/launcher3/SearchDropTargetBar.java |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/src/com/android/launcher3/SearchDropTargetBar.java b/src/com/android/launcher3/SearchDropTargetBar.java index b58964b03..38daadd8a 100644 --- a/src/com/android/launcher3/SearchDropTargetBar.java +++ b/src/com/android/launcher3/SearchDropTargetBar.java @@ -80,8 +80,16 @@ public class SearchDropTargetBar extends FrameLayout implements DragController.D } public void setQsbSearchBar(View qsb) { + float alpha = 1f; + int visibility = View.VISIBLE; + if (mQSBSearchBar != null) { + alpha = mQSBSearchBar.getAlpha(); + visibility = mQSBSearchBar.getVisibility(); + } mQSBSearchBar = qsb; if (mQSBSearchBar != null) { + mQSBSearchBar.setAlpha(alpha); + mQSBSearchBar.setVisibility(visibility); if (mEnableDropDownDropTargets) { mQSBSearchBarAnim = LauncherAnimUtils.ofFloat(mQSBSearchBar, "translationY", 0, -mBarHeight); |